Vallah Waterfall is a waterfall located in the Edremit district of Balıkesir, known for its natural beauty.
Story
Vallah Waterfall is situated near the Güre town, part of Balıkesir's Edremit district, at the foothills of Mount Ida (Kaz Dağları). This waterfall is a popular destination, especially for nature walkers and trekking enthusiasts. Fed by the rich vegetation and cool waters of Mount Ida, the waterfall offers a visual feast to its visitors for a large part of the year. The area around the waterfall is notable for its endemic plant species and diverse wildlife. The region also hosts mythological stories; Mount Ida is known to be the subject of many legends. Access to Vallah Waterfall is generally provided via stabilized roads and paths starting from Güre. The area where the waterfall is located has preserved its natural structure and has not been subjected to any modern development. Visitors can refresh themselves in the cool waters of the waterfall, picnic in the surrounding forested area, or take photographs. The waterfall offers a more magnificent view, especially in spring and autumn, when water levels are high.
